Parallel Huffman Decoding with Applications to JPEG Files

A simple parallel algorithm for decoding a Huffman encoded file is presented, exploiting the tendency of Huffman codes to resynchronize quickly, i.e. recovering after possible decoding errors, in most cases. Partitioning Files for Huffman Encoding

When the relative frequencies of characters vary significantly within a single file, it may be desirable to use a different Huffman code on different phases of the file. This note presents an heuristic algorithm for determining the boundaries between phases. l. Introduction Huffman encoding [3J is a well-known technique for data compression. Quality Adaptive Low-Rank Based JPEG Decoding with Applications

Small compression noises, despite being transparent to human eyes, can adversely affect the results of many image restoration processes, if left unaccounted for. Especially, compression noises are highly detrimental to inverse operators of high-boosting (sharpening) nature, such as deblurring and superresolution against a convolution kernel.
